Titan Creative - Digital Marketing Agency Can Be Fun For Anyone
An Unbiased View of Titan Creative - Digital Marketing AgencyTable of ContentsThe Best Strategy To Use For Titan Creative - Digital Marketing AgencySome Ideas on Titan Creative - Digital Marketing Agency You Should KnowThe Definitive Guide to Titan Creative - Digital Marketing AgencyTitan Creative - Digital Marketing Agency Fundamentals ExplainedSe